          Spicy KETO crackers.
          Kind of unconventional I know. But was so easy for so little effort. 1 with Cajun seasoning and 1 with Mexicali seasoning from excaliber. Topped with everything bagel seasoning.

                            RafterW that looks really good 👍. I’ve never heard of that dish. Where does it originate from?

                            RafterWR Offline
                            RafterWR Offline
                            RafterW
                            Power User Regular Contributors Cast Iron Big Green Egg
                            wrote on last edited by
                            #6081

                            cdavis Italy. It is a potato dumpling of sorts, they soak up alot of flavor in the sauce of your dish. There is spinach, kielbasa, diced tomato, a splash of chicken stock, onion, garlic, mozzarella and parmesan cheese in the dish.
